Lord Bracken was the Lord of the Stone Hedge and the head of House Bracken during the reign of kings Daeron II and Aerys I Targaryen.[2] His given name is unknown.

History

During the First Blackfyre Rebellion, Lord Bracken declared for House Blackfyre. He sailed to Myr to hire crossbowmen to aid Daemon I Blackfyre and Bittersteel, but was delayed by storms.[2]

In 211 AC, Lord Bracken is dying. As he outlived his eldest son, who died during the Great Spring Sickness, his second son, the belligerent Ser Otho, was set to inherit Stone Hedge.[2]

It is unclear if he died by 212 AC or not. The conspirators of the Second Blackfyre Rebellion hoped for Otho to join the forces of House Bracken to their own, which may imply Otho had succeeded his father.[1]
